1 | /* |
1 | /* |
2 | * This file is part of Deliantra, the Roguelike Realtime MMORPG. |
2 | * This file is part of Deliantra, the Roguelike Realtime MMORPG. |
3 | * |
3 | * |
4 | * Copyright (©) 2005,2006,2007,2008 Marc Alexander Lehmann / Robin Redeker / the Deliantra team |
4 | * Copyright (©) 2005,2006,2007,2008,2009,2010 Marc Alexander Lehmann / Robin Redeker / the Deliantra team |
5 | * |
5 | * |
6 | * Deliantra is free software: you can redistribute it and/or modify it under |
6 | * Deliantra is free software: you can redistribute it and/or modify it under |
7 | * the terms of the Affero GNU General Public License as published by the |
7 | * the terms of the Affero GNU General Public License as published by the |
8 | * Free Software Foundation, either version 3 of the License, or (at your |
8 | * Free Software Foundation, either version 3 of the License, or (at your |
9 | * option) any later version. |
9 | * option) any later version. |
… | |
… | |
20 | * The authors can be reached via e-mail to <support@deliantra.net> |
20 | * The authors can be reached via e-mail to <support@deliantra.net> |
21 | */ |
21 | */ |
22 | |
22 | |
23 | /* image.c */ |
23 | /* image.c */ |
24 | int is_valid_faceset(int fsn); |
24 | int is_valid_faceset(int fsn); |
25 | void free_socket_images(void); |
25 | void free_socket_images(); |
26 | void read_client_images(void); |
26 | void read_client_images(); |
27 | void SetFaceMode(char *buf, int len, client *ns); |
27 | void SetFaceMode(char *buf, int len, client *ns); |
28 | void AskFaceCmd(char *buf, int len, client *ns); |
28 | void AskFaceCmd(char *buf, int len, client *ns); |
29 | void send_image_info(client *ns, char *params); |
29 | void send_image_info(client *ns, char *params); |
30 | void send_image_sums(client *ns, char *params); |
30 | void send_image_sums(client *ns, char *params); |
31 | /* info.c */ |
31 | /* info.c */ |
… | |
… | |
34 | void new_info_map_except(int color, maptile *map, object *op, const char *str); |
34 | void new_info_map_except(int color, maptile *map, object *op, const char *str); |
35 | void new_info_map(int color, maptile *map, const char *str); |
35 | void new_info_map(int color, maptile *map, const char *str); |
36 | void set_title(object *pl, char *buf); |
36 | void set_title(object *pl, char *buf); |
37 | void draw_magic_map(object *pl); |
37 | void draw_magic_map(object *pl); |
38 | /* init.c */ |
38 | /* init.c */ |
39 | void init_ericserver(void); |
39 | void init_ericserver(); |
40 | void free_all_newserver(void); |
40 | void free_all_newserver(); |
41 | void final_free_player(player *pl); |
41 | void final_free_player(player *pl); |
42 | /* item.c */ |
42 | /* item.c */ |
43 | void esrv_draw_look(player *pl); |
43 | void esrv_draw_look(player *pl); |
44 | void esrv_send_inventory(object *pl, object *op); |
44 | void esrv_send_inventory(object *pl, object *op); |
45 | void esrv_update_item(int flags, object *pl, object *op); |
45 | void esrv_update_item(int flags, object *pl, object *op); |
… | |
… | |
52 | void MarkItem(char *data, int len, player *pl); |
52 | void MarkItem(char *data, int len, player *pl); |
53 | void LookAt(char *buf, int len, player *pl); |
53 | void LookAt(char *buf, int len, player *pl); |
54 | void esrv_move_object(object *pl, tag_t to, tag_t tag, long nrof); |
54 | void esrv_move_object(object *pl, tag_t to, tag_t tag, long nrof); |
55 | /* loop.c */ |
55 | /* loop.c */ |
56 | void RequestInfo(char *buf, int len, client *ns); |
56 | void RequestInfo(char *buf, int len, client *ns); |
57 | void watchdog(void); |
57 | void watchdog(); |
58 | /* lowlevel.c */ |
58 | /* lowlevel.c */ |
59 | void write_cs_stats(void); |
59 | void write_cs_stats(); |
60 | /* request.c */ |
60 | /* request.c */ |
61 | void SetUp(char *buf, int len, client *ns); |
61 | void SetUp(char *buf, int len, client *ns); |
62 | void AddMeCmd(char *buf, int len, client *ns); |
62 | void AddMeCmd(char *buf, int len, client *ns); |
63 | void ToggleExtendedInfos(char *buf, int len, client *ns); |
63 | void ToggleExtendedInfos(char *buf, int len, client *ns); |
64 | void ToggleExtendedText (char *buf, int len, client *ns); |
|
|
65 | void AskSmooth(char *buf, int len, client *ns); |
64 | void AskSmooth(char *buf, int len, client *ns); |
66 | void PlayerCmd(char *buf, int len, player *pl); |
65 | void PlayerCmd(char *buf, int len, player *pl); |
67 | void NewPlayerCmd(char *buf, int len, player *pl); |
66 | void NewPlayerCmd(char *buf, int len, player *pl); |
68 | void ReplyCmd(char *buf, int len, client *ns); |
67 | void ReplyCmd(char *buf, int len, client *ns); |
69 | void VersionCmd(char *buf, int len, client *ns); |
68 | void VersionCmd(char *buf, int len, client *ns); |